What is Infrastructure Delivery Routing?

Infrastructure delivery routing refers to the processes and methodologies involved in effectively planning and executing the delivery of goods. This routing is crucial for ensuring that deliveries are executed in a timely and cost-effective manner, which can significantly impact customer satisfaction and company reputation.

The Importance of Effective Delivery Routing

1. Cost Efficiency: By employing optimized routing strategies, businesses can reduce fuel consumption and labor costs.
2. Timely Deliveries: Efficient delivery routing ensures that customers receive their orders on time, which is critical for maintaining strong relationships.
3. Improved Customer Satisfaction: When deliveries are reliable, customer loyalty increases, leading to repeat business and referrals.
4. Resource Optimization: Proper routing minimizes the strain on resources and maximizes the utility of the delivery fleet.

Key Components of Infrastructure Delivery Routing

Understanding the core components of infrastructure delivery routing can help businesses make informed decisions about their logistics strategies.

1. Order Clustering

Order clustering is a strategy that groups deliveries in proximity to each other, optimizing routes and saving time. For an in-depth look at this technique, check out our article on optimizing delivery efficiency with order clustering for routing.

2. Route Optimization Technologies

Employing sophisticated software tools can simplify complex routing decisions. These technologies can analyze traffic patterns, road conditions, and delivery windows to propose the most efficient routes.

3. Delivery Time Windows

Establishing clear delivery time windows helps set customer expectations. Well-defined timeframes allow for better scheduling and resource allocation.

4. Real-Time Tracking

Real-time tracking of deliveries enhances transparency and allows customers to receive updates on their shipments. Implementing a system that includes live tracking can greatly improve client confidence.

Best Practices for Infrastructure Delivery Routing

To implement successful infrastructure delivery routing, consider the following best practices:

1. Leverage Data Analytics

Collect and analyze data from past deliveries to identify patterns and optimize future routes. Understanding factors such as delivery times and traffic conditions will inform better decision-making.

2. Use Automated Routing Solutions

Investing in automated routing solutions can streamline the planning process. By automating portions of your delivery management, you can improve accuracy and reduce labor costs.

3. Regularly Update Your Routing Strategies

The logistics landscape is continuously changing. Regularly reassess your delivery routing strategies to adapt to new challenges and opportunities. This includes evaluating your infrastructure and service capabilities.

4. Train Your Staff

Implementing any new delivery routing strategy is only as effective as your team’s understanding of it. Conduct training sessions to keep your staff updated on best practices and technologies.

5. Monitor Key Performance Indicators (KPIs)

Tracking performance metrics such as delivery times, costs per delivery, and customer satisfaction will help you identify areas for improvement. KPIs provide visibility into your logistics operation’s effectiveness.

Frequently Asked Questions

What is the definition of infrastructure delivery routing?

Infrastructure delivery routing is the systematic approach to planning and executing the efficient delivery of goods, focusing on cost-efficient methodologies and maintaining high service reliability.

How does order clustering enhance delivery efficiency?

Order clustering groups nearby deliveries, reducing overall travel time and fuel consumption. This optimization leads to quicker service and lower operational costs.

What technologies can improve delivery routing?

Advanced routing software, GPS tracking, and data analytics tools can enhance delivery routing by providing insights, optimizing paths, and ensuring real-time updates on delivery statuses.

Why is real-time tracking important for deliveries?

Real-time tracking improves customer satisfaction by providing transparency. It allows customers to monitor their orders, ensuring they are informed and building trust in your service.

What should I consider when planning delivery routes?

When planning delivery routes, consider factors such as traffic patterns, delivery time windows, the capacity of vehicles, and the distribution of deliveries to optimize efficiency.
